Herbal or dietary supplements must be asked about and noted on the patient's chart preoperatively

Indicate whether the statement is true or false.


ANS: T
Patients are advised to report all herbal supplements, because some supplements can cause serious complications such as bleeding. Tranquilizers, cortisone, reserpine, alcohol, herbal preparations, and recreational drugs, for example, influence the course of anesthesia.
